Beware of Underestimating the Power of Proper Fit and Material Quality
A common mistake is assuming that a crown or Invisalign tray will last just because it looks good initially. However, improper fitting can lead to cracks, chipping, or misalignment over time. The quality of materials also plays a crucial role—cheap or outdated options may fail prematurely. How do I keep my dental work functioning smoothly over time?
Maintaining your crowns and Invisalign aligners requires a combination of the right tools and consistent habits. Personally, I swear by using a high-quality ultrasonic toothbrush like the Philips Sonicare ProtectiveClean. Its advanced sonic technology effectively removes plaque without damaging delicate restorations, making it ideal for long-term oral health. Additionally, I incorporate interdental brushes, such as GUM Eez-Thru, which help me clean around crowns and between teeth where floss might miss. Regular use of these tools not only preserves the integrity of your dental work but also enhances overall oral hygiene.
Another game-changer for me has been a water flosser, specifically the Waterpik Aquarius. It gently flushes out debris and bacteria from hard-to-reach areas, ensuring my Invisalign trays and crowns stay clean and free from buildup. This is especially important because trapped plaque can compromise the longevity of your dental investments. Combining these tools with a consistent brushing routine and fluoride mouthwash helps maintain a healthy, durable smile.

What strategies can I implement for lasting results?
Beyond gadgets, establishing a structured oral care routine is vital. I set reminders on my smartphone to replace my toothbrush every three months and to schedule biannual dental checkups. During appointments, my dentist assesses the condition of my crowns and Invisalign to catch any early signs of wear or damage. Regular professional cleanings, combined with my at-home practices, ensure that my smile stays healthy and functional for years.
Furthermore, I have learned the importance of avoiding certain habits, like biting on hard objects or chewing ice, which can crack crowns or dislodge aligners. Investing in protective gear, such as a night guard if you grind your teeth, adds an extra layer of protection. These simple yet effective strategies help extend the life of your dental work and prevent costly repairs down the line.
